Death & Flowers

Here I am again! Did you miss me? It was a bit lonely during the winter I was all alone and hadn't a single visitor.
He looked a bit funny but the families in the city park didn't care that he was different after all it was a warm spring day. A day good to wear only a t-shirt and smell the air of spring flowers.
The picnic basket was packed and everyone was in a good mood. There's nothing like stuffing yourself while others watch, said John
Madeleine agreed, that crazy covid-19 had lasted long enough. She had never been able to taste the cheese, cake, whipped cream, lemonade and pie because of that stupid virus.
It was all a scam, said John who poured down some more coke, don't be such a wimp Mad, it's all in your head.
He thought the cheerful guest who looked a bit swollen was quite funny. Feel free to join us for dinner, said John, are you the clown of the city park. Sure, chuckled the uninvited guest. It's super cozy here and I'll stay until the end when there's no more man or dog left.
Let's toast to that, said John as he raised his cola glass and popped out the piece of lemon with his little finger. He didn't like sour surprises and Madeline should have known that long ago.
Before he could utter a word, his head and heart were pounding in sync and after a stab in his side he threw in the towel.
Death had finally got his way.
